Ron Chandler is an Associate Professor at Michigan State University's BioMolecular Science Gateway, where he holds faculty appointments in both the Cell & Molecular Biology Program and the Genetics & Genome Sciences Program. His research focuses on molecular mechanisms linking chromatin remodeling to chromatin biology, epigenetics, and cell signaling in the uterine endometrium.
Research Interests: The Chandler Lab investigates how disruptions in chromatin remodeling contribute to endometriosis and associated cancers, emphasizing the interplay between epigenetic regulation and reproductive health.
